The piece closes with a warning to others about potential risks in elder care facilities. It emphasizes the importance of thoroughly researching facility ownership structures, ensuring transparent and ethical handling of financial matters, and seeking independent advocacy or legal guidance when concerns arise. The recommendation is to contact state regulators, long-term care ombudsmen, and appropriate insurers to protect a loved one's rights and well-being.

Top Canine Companions for Older Adults
Dogs can greatly improve the lives of older adults by offering emotional support and encouraging physical activity, with factors such as size, temperament, and grooming needs being crucial in selecting a suitable breed. Senior dogs often make ideal companions for this demographic, promoting social connections and requiring care routines that align with seniors' capabilities.
